David Micallef has been appointed as Head of Business Unit within PwC’s Digital Services section.

“David will lead the Cloud and Infrastructure and IT Managed Services team. In this role, he will also be appointed as a Company Director of PwC Digital Services Malta Limited,” a statement by PwC read.

“This well-deserved milestone reflects our continued investment in the capabilities that enable us to deliver innovative, future-focused solutions while creating meaningful opportunities for our people to grow and thrive.”

He has been with PwC for over three years and prior to that he spent nearly 13 years with Megabyte Ltd, a company which PwC had acquired in 2023.
